Evaluating Negotiation Cost for QoS-aware Service Composition
نویسندگان
چکیده
The value of commercial Service-Based Applications (SBAs) will depend not only on their functionality, but also on the value of their non-functional properties, known as QoS attributes, that are not tied to a specific functionality, but rather to its delivery features. QoS values may vary according to the provision strategies of providers as well as users’ requirements expressed as global constraints on the SBA QoS. Automatic negotiation is a viable approach to drive QoS-aware selection of services for SBAs, but its adoption may result computationally expensive due to the communication overhead among the involved negotiators, so limiting its application to real service-based scenarios. In this paper, an empirical evaluation of the impact of negotiation communication costs occurred when composing services to deliver a QoS-aware SBA is carried out, in order to estimate the advantages and disadvantages of negotiation in a market of services, and to identify negotiation parameters settings for which communication costs can be compensated by an increased probability for the negotiation to succeed.
منابع مشابه
Automatic QoS-aware Web Services Composition based on Set-Cover Problem
By definition, web-services composition works on developing merely optimum coordination among a number of available web-services to provide a new composed web-service intended to satisfy some users requirements for which a single web service is not (good) enough. In this article, the formulation of the automatic web-services composition is proposed as several set-cover problems and an approxima...
متن کاملBNQM: A Bayesian Network based QoS Model for Grid service composition
The QoS attributes of Grid services play important roles in several tasks in Grid computing such as QoS-aware service composition, service negotiation, resource management, service discovery and scheduling. By considering the dynamic aspects of the Grid environments and also the uncertainty related to Grid services, in this paper, we present BNQM, a Bayesian network based probabilistic QoS Mode...
متن کاملSemantic Constraint and QoS-Aware Large-Scale Web Service Composition
Service-oriented architecture facilitates the running time of interactions by using business integration on the networks. Currently, web services are considered as the best option to provide Internet services. Due to an increasing number of Web users and the complexity of users’ queries, simple and atomic services are not able to meet the needs of users; and to provide complex services, it requ...
متن کاملQoS-Based web service composition based on genetic algorithm
Quality of service (QoS) is an important issue in the design and management of web service composition. QoS in web services consists of various non-functional factors, such as execution cost, execution time, availability, successful execution rate, and security. In recent years, the number of available web services has proliferated, and then offered the same services increasingly. The same web ...
متن کاملEfficient QoS management for QoS-aware web service composition
In this paper, we propose an efficient QoS management approach for QoS-aware web service composition. In the approach, we classify web services according to theirs similarity and then design a QoS tree to manage the QoS the classified web services. Besides, by querying the managed QoS, we propose a QoS-aware web service composition via a particle swarm optimisation algorithm to perform fast web...
متن کامل